Rolex Air-King Reviews: A Spectrum of Opinions

Online forums dedicated to Rolex watches, such as those focusing specifically on the Air-King, are treasure troves of information. They provide a raw, unfiltered look at the experiences of owners and prospective buyers. The 116900 Air-King, in particular, generates a diverse range of opinions. While some hail it as an underappreciated gem, others express reservations, often centering around specific design choices.

A common thread running through many positive reviews emphasizes the watch's vintage-inspired design. The 34mm (later 40mm) case, the straightforward dial with its prominent markers, and the overall minimalist aesthetic appeal to those seeking a less flamboyant Rolex. Many appreciate its subtle elegance and the sense of understated luxury it conveys. It's a watch that doesn't scream for attention but rewards the wearer with a quiet confidence. The legibility of the dial, even in low-light conditions (despite the lume criticisms discussed below), is often praised. The robust build quality, a hallmark of Rolex, consistently receives positive feedback. Owners frequently comment on the watch's durability and reliability, highlighting its ability to withstand everyday wear and tear.

However, the negative reviews are equally insightful. A significant portion of the criticism focuses on the lack of luminous material on the hands and markers. While some find this a minor inconvenience, others consider it a significant drawback, particularly for those who rely on their watch for nighttime readability. This complaint is often echoed by those who also own other Rolex models with brighter lume, making the Air-King's subdued glow feel noticeably deficient. This issue is frequently discussed in detail within the Rolex Air-King Uhr Forum, with users sharing their experiences and offering various solutions, such as aftermarket lume applications (though this voids the warranty). The perceived lack of lume is often linked to the watch's vintage-inspired design, with some arguing that it contributes to its classic charm.

Beyond the lume issue, the thickness of the watch is another point of contention. Some find the 116900 slightly too thick for a watch of its size, impacting its comfort on the wrist. This is a subjective matter, of course, and depends on individual wrist size and preferences. However, it's a recurring theme in online discussions and something prospective buyers should consider.
